The Colour of 2025: Embracing Mocha Mousse in Your Wedding Flowers

Writer's picture: Posey RosePosey Rose

Behold, the Pantone colour of 2025, Mocha Mousse—a captivating, warm hue of brown that we at Posey Rose adore! This earthy shade radiates beauty, making it a splendid choice for any season.

For a winter wedding, we envision it harmonising with lush greenery and soft champagne tones, creating a magical atmosphere perfect for festive celebrations. As autumn arrives, vibrant oranges would dance alongside Mocha Mousse, evoking the true essence of the season and its rich, earthy vibes.

When spring and summer grace us with their warmth, we eagerly anticipate pairing this enchanting colour with shades of blue and champagne, celebrating the joyous spirit of the season while showcasing the splendid blooms that thrive in these warmer months.

While not every flower may don this exquisite hue, rose enthusiasts will find delight in the large-headed toffee rose. In the spring, the charming ranunculus would be a lovely addition, while a rusty gladiolus would shine brilliantly in the summer, accompanied by dahlia and the stunning spider chrysanthemum to embody the essence of autumn.

We eagerly await the creative ways couples of 2025 and 2026 will weave these earthy brown tones into their wedding florals.
